An conversation concerning histaminergic and opioidergic methods within the CNS was suggested approximately thirty several years in the past, as a result of an observation that morphine administration resulted in the release of histamine and its elevated turnover while in the periaqueductal grey (Nishibori, Oishi, Itoh, & Saeki, 1985), suggesting that analgesia made by opioids might be associated with the stimulation of histamine receptors for the supraspinal level. You will also find details suggesting that ligands of histamine receptors may well modulate the analgesic motion of opioids; nonetheless, the location and manner of this interaction differ in between the spinal or supraspinal level, and depend upon the subtype of histamine receptor associated (Mobarakeh et al., 2002; Mobarakeh et al., 2006; Mobarakeh, Takahashi, & Yanai, 2009). Exclusively, a series of studies over the last 20 years has demonstrated that in H1, H2, or H3 receptor‐KO mice, morphine‐induced antinociception was noticeably augmented when compared into Proleviate Blocks Pain Receptors the wild‐type controls in styles of acute pain. H1 receptor‐KO mice confirmed a diminished spontaneous nociceptive threshold as they responded to significantly reduce pain stimuli when put next for their controls (Mobarakeh et al.

APLNR is current within the human cardiac and dentate myocytes and vascular endothelial cells. The apelin (endogenous ligand of APLNR)/APLNR method is associated with several physiological and pathological procedures, which include heart problems, angiogenesis, Electricity metabolism, and humoral homeostasis 35. The apelin/APLNR method exerts twin outcomes on acute inflammatory, and neuropathic pain. The APLNR antagonist ML221 lessens pain hypersensitivity induced by Serious systolic injury and inhibits ERK phosphorylation from the spinal dorsal horn 36. Apelin (intracerebroventricular injection, 0.four μmol/rat) diminished the pain threshold during the rat tail flapping experiment 36. The contradictory benefits regarding the part of apelin/APLNR in pain modulation are tough to describe. It could be related to the sort of pain, dose, type of animal, route of administration, and time of injection while in the animal styles. The most crucial molecular mechanisms underlying apelin/APLNR-induced pain are connected with opioid receptors, γ-aminobutyric acid receptors, along with the ERK pathway 37.
